COLLEGE STREET SCHOOL.
MEETING OF THE COMMITTEE. A meeting of the College Street School Committee was held L.st night, the chairman, Air J. JJ. Lrerraiid, presiding. Others present were Alis Out and .Messrs I. il. Uill, i\ Curville, J. \V. Rutherford and S. bauson. Ihe headmaster's leport stated that the Juno quart.r closed wit.i an average attendance 01 481, out ot an average roll, number of 584. 'i lie number on the roll at the close ol the (punter was 5G9. Prevailing sickness had lieuu the chief cause of the io»v aver age, ' ' • All offer by Mis Stubbs to provide a stall in the Square every Saturday morning for sis months in order to raise funds for tho new ii.l'auts' scltpo! building was :e----ccivod with expressions Jnf gratification. It was decided lo enlist till! aid ol a Committee of ladies to in conducting sales of produce at the stall, . ' Tho chairman report?:! that the recent frosty weather had necessitated flit-' installation of Mine form of heating apparatus in tho municipal, baud room, which is at present occupied dining tie.' day by a class from the school. On one particularly cold morning when the tnerctiry full very low m the glass it was licceßsarV to take lie children out-of the room and engage tin m in exercises to promote a. vigorous circulation before lessons could he commenced. The following morning was almost equally as cold, and worse still, was wet, so thai tie: children had lo cilddrU tin' cold in ihe room, Tho matter of a stove was then. ft Usidered, and il was di tided to purchase one "ill: a lengthy pipo attached ill a cost of £6 10s, which exp.nse would bo borne by tho Hoard. An arrangement had been come to with the band that the stove would be removed when the new buildings were ready for occupation.
